What you'll learn

In this course you will learn how to use the Microsoft Fakes provided with Visual Studio 2012 to isolate your tests from the dependencies of the classes you are unit testing. It will teach you how to use stubs to track dependency collaboration and to control program flow. It will also teach you how to use shims to test legacy code.
